### Step 4: Enable the sweeper

With the inventory snapshot verified, you can turn on Gleanhound, our orphaned-resource sweeper. It scans for volumes, snapshots, and load balancers with no owning deployment and tags them for deletion after a grace window. New team members: start in dry-run mode for at least one full cycle and review the report before allowing real deletions. Apply the standard rollout configuration, reproduced below for convenience.

deployment values, yafop-tahof:
HOLIX_HOST=holix.zemvarsys.internal
HOLIX_PORT=3306

Subject: Key rotation — Pagemill incremental rebuild service

Hi,

As part of this quarter's review, we've rotated the credential used by Pagemill, our incremental static site rebuild service. The old key stopped triggering partial rebuilds as of last night; full rebuilds were unaffected. The new key scopes to the rebuild-trigger endpoint only and expires in 90 days, consistent with the policy you flagged in the Brindlewood audit. Rotation logs are attached for verification. For your records, the replacement key is below.

service key, fawip-bajef: kto11_Qt5wZK9vdNC

Finance Review Summary — Marketing Budget Adjustment

Short version for department heads: we're trimming marketing spend by roughly 12% for the back half of the year. The Larkspur campaign stays funded; the Venton trade-show circuit gets cut. Savings go toward shoring up the Orvell product launch. Nobody's thrilled, but the numbers are the numbers. Please hold questions until the all-hands. Here's the part that stays in this room.

management briefing: Project Ulavan slips by two quarters because of the staffing delay.

As part of migrating the Tarnwell build to the hermetic Ossifrage toolchain, all network access during compilation is removed and every input is pinned by content hash. Sandbox escapes are treated as build failures, and cache poisoning is mitigated via dual-signed artifacts. For review purposes, the sandbox resource ceilings and verification retry parameters are fixed at the following values.

constants for bagag-fawip:
BUDGETS = {
    "wenius": 400,
    "brieth": 224,
    "rusath": 783,
    "eliys": 187,
    "aldax": 737,
    "ralion": 818,
    "istius": 153,
}